Browsing the L1 Visa Process in Delhi: Your Comprehensive Overview to Success Charting the L1 visa procedure in Delhi can be a complex endeavor, requiring a clear understanding of the different eligibility requirements and documentation needed for a successful application. With distinct categories for managers and specialized knowledge employees, applicants https://visagiftcards75173.blogsmine.com/37637316/l1-visa-explained-essential-insights-for-applicants